Archive Organization

Our open archive is organized in a manner that enables easy browsing. Datasets are organized into directories in a YYYY/MM/DD style of tree, with many datasets also including additional levels for location and hour. Universally across all available data, timestamps are represenated in UTC time. All filenames are unique, regardless of their tree depth. These standards enable easy human-readability and also programmatic retrieval.

The archive is organized into two separate top-level trees: by project and by instrument type.

Within the instrument array trees (ie. themis/asi, trex/rgb, etc.), you will find several datasets. Types of datasets are organized into their own trees, depicted by 'streamX' or 'lX' (for 'level'). Older datasets will use the 'streamX' format, and newer datasets will use the 'lX' format. Below is a breakdown of what each means:

Stream format:

  • stream0: full resolution raw data
  • stream1: real-time data streams
  • stream2: summary-level data products (keograms, montages, etc.)
  • stream3: ancillary files, usually not needed for analysis
  • grid_files: network-wide grid files

Level format:

  • l0: full resolution raw data
  • l1: full resolution processed data
  • l2: summary-level data products (keograms, montages, etc.)
  • l3: high level data products (network-wide grid files)

Additional:

  • rt-fullres: real-time live feed images and movies
  • skymaps: UCalgary-designed skymapping files (used to project all-sky imager data onto maps)

Note that some datasets do not follow either stream/level formats, however the organization will be easy to understand. All datasets have consistent naming and organization standard, and will not change partway through the dataset.
